What is Pony Club?

Pony Club is part of a national organization (United States Pony Clubs) that is dedicated to teaching riding skills and horse management to youth under the age of 21. The core of USPC is the local club. USPC supports the ideal of a thoroughly happy, comfortable horseperson, riding across a natural country, with complete confidence and and perfect balance on a horse or pony equally happy and confident and free from pain or bewilderment.

USPC's Mission Statement

The mission of the United States Pony Clubs is to provide a program for youth that teaches riding, mounted sports, and the care of horses and ponies, thereby developing responsibility, moral judgment, leadership, and self-confidence.

About Rainbow Pony Club

Rainbow Pony Club is in the Southern California region of USPC. We are located at Willow Glen Equestrian Centre in El Cajon. In order to participate, Pony Clubbers must pay national, regional, and local dues, and a quarterly grounds and maintenance fee. Parents play a big role in Pony Club; without their help, it would not be possible.

The core of our program is the working rally, or mounted meeting. Club members come to these meetings with their mounts for riding lessons, horse management instruction, mounted games, or other activities. We also hold unmounted meetings. Local clubs may send teams of riders to local, regional, or national "competitive rallies" in combined training, show jumping, dressage, mounted games, and the tetrathlon (riding, running, swimming, and marksmanship). Teamwork, horse management, good horsemanship, and good sportsmanship are just as important as performance.

There are nine levels in Pony Club, called "ratings." Members start out as "unrated." They learn at their own pace and take the test for each rating when they are ready. Each rating includes riding tests (in the ring, in the open, and jumping), stable management, and oral testing. Testing for the first five ratings (D-1, D-2, D-3, C-1, and C-2) is done by local examiners. The C-3 rating is done by regional examiners, while the three higheset levels (B, H-A, and A) are national ratings tested by national examiners. They require a high degree of skill, knowledge, and horsemanship experience.

Joining

To join Rainbow Pony Club, a child must be under 21 years of age as of January 1 of the current year. RPC does not provide mounts; members are responsible for their own. A Pony Club mount may be either a horse or pony. Horses and ponies used must be at least five years old, and may not be stallions.
